Common Signs of Roofing System Damage



When you check your roof covering, look carefully for usual indications of damages that can lead to bigger issues later on.


Start by checking for missing out on or broken shingles; these can permit water to leak in and cause leakages. see this here to granule loss, which can show that roof shingles are maturing and losing their safety layer.

Next off, take a look at the blinking around chimneys and vents. If you find corrosion or gaps, water can conveniently enter your home.

Seek drooping locations on the roofing, as this might indicate architectural damage or the build-up of wetness.

Don't fail to remember to check for moss or algae growth; while they could seem safe, they can trap moisture and increase deterioration.

Examine the seamless gutters for particles and indications of water overflow, as this can indicate a blockage or incorrect drainage.

Finally, keep an eye on your ceilings and wall surfaces for water stains or peeling paint, as these could be clues that your roofing is dripping.

Addressing these signs promptly can help you stay clear of a lot more considerable fixings and prolong the lifespan of your roofing.

Inspecting Your Roofing Frequently



Regular roof covering examinations are vital for maintaining the integrity of your home. By maintaining a close eye on your roof, you can capture problems early, saving on your own money and time in the future. Purpose to check your roof covering at the very least twice a year-- once in the spring and when in the autumn. This timing helps you resolve any type of damages brought on by wintertime weather and get ready for the forthcoming seasons.

When checking, begin with the ground. Use field glasses to look for missing out on roof shingles, split floor tiles, or any type of indications of wear. Look for drooping locations or dark areas, which could indicate leakages. Do not forget to examine the rain gutters, as stopped up or damaged gutters can lead to water build-up and roofing damages.

If you fit, go up to the roof covering to obtain a better look. Focus on flashing around chimneys and vents, as these locations are prone to leakages. Beware and guarantee you have a risk-free means to access your roof covering.

Routine maintenance, like cleansing debris and moss, will certainly additionally help lengthen your roof's lifespan. Remaining aggressive regarding inspections can assist you find surprise problems before they intensify.

When to Call an Expert



Commonly, house owners are reluctant to call an expert for roofing issues, assuming they can take care of repairs themselves. Nonetheless, understanding when to seek assistance can conserve you time, money, and anxiety. If you observe substantial leakages, comprehensive water damage, or dark areas on your ceilings, don't wait. These indications might show major underlying problems that require professional interest.

If your roofing is older than two decades, also minor problems can intensify rapidly. Split roof shingles, missing ceramic tiles, or sagging locations are red flags that call for an expert inspection.

Furthermore, if you're uneasy climbing onto your roofing system or do not have the necessary devices and experience, it's ideal to leave it to the pros.

When tornado damage occurs, such as hail storm or high winds, it's crucial to obtain an analysis from a certified specialist. They can recognize hidden concerns that can compromise your home's stability.

Ultimately, if you have actually tried repairs however the trouble lingers, don't think twice to hire a specialist. They'll bring the understanding and skills needed to guarantee your roof covering is safe.
